National Grid Restores 30% Of Service To Ocean Pkwy Customers, But 100 More Are Now Without Service

National Grid vans pack the Ocean Parkway service roads as over 300 crews respond to the scene.National Grid has resumed service to 30 percent of the Gravesend households that have been without natural gas since Tuesday [/1000-households-affected-in-ocean-parkway-gas-crisis-national-grid-says-service-to-be-restored-friday/] , when a nearby water main leak caused gas lines to flood.
